Rebel TMC MPs to meet Speaker Om Birla for recognition

Rebel Trinamool Congress MPs are set to meet Lok Sabha Speaker Om Birla on Monday seeking recognition as a separate group. They claim the backing of 19 out of 28 TMC MPs and plan to align with the NDA.

Cooch Behar MP Jagadish Chandra Barma Basunia said the faction wants Kakoli Ghosh Dastidar as leader and Satabdi Roy as deputy leader. The group also plans to meet West Bengal Chief Minister Suvendu Adhikari in Delhi on Sunday.

Basunia stated the rebels aim to be recognised as the real TMC and sit alongside NDA MPs. He cited the high-handedness of Abhishek Banerjee as a key reason for the split.

In a related development the party lost its Delhi base after MP Partha Bhowmick vacated the bungalow at 20 Dr Rajendra Prasad Road that served as its operational headquarters. Bhowmick who is among the 19 rebels received a new allotment on June 9.
